SUMMARY: The Secretary announces deadline dates for the receipt of
documents and other information from applicants and institutions
participating in certain Federal student aid programs authorized under
title IV of the Higher Education Act of 1965, as amended (HEA), for the
2025-2026 award year. These programs, administered by the Department of
Education (Department), provide financial assistance to students
attending eligible postsecondary educational institutions to help them
pay their educational costs. The Federal student aid programs (title
IV, HEA programs) covered by this deadline date notice are the Pell
Grant, Direct Loan, TEACH Grant, and Campus-Based (FSEOG and FWS)
programs. Assistance Listing Numbers: 84.007 FSEOG Program; 84.033 FWS
Program; 84.063 Pell Grant Program; 84.268 Direct Loan Program; and
84.379 TEACH Grant Program.

Table A provides information and deadline dates for receipt of the
FAFSA
[[Page 57187]]
form, corrections to and signatures for the FAFSA form, ISIRs, and
FAFSA Submission Summary, and verification documents.
The deadline date for the receipt of a FAFSA form by the
Department's FAFSA Processing System (FPS) is June 30, 2026, regardless
of the method that the applicant uses to submit the FAFSA form. The
deadline date for the receipt of corrections, notices of change of
address or institution, or requests for a duplicate FAFSA Submission
Summary is September 12, 2026.
For all title IV, HEA programs, an ISIR or FAFSA Submission Summary
for the student must be received by the institution no later than the
student's last date of enrollment for the 2025-2026 award year or
September 19, 2026, whichever is earlier. Note that a FAFSA form must
be submitted and an ISIR or FAFSA Submission Summary received for the
dependent student for whom a parent is applying for a Direct PLUS Loan.
Except for students selected for Verification Tracking Groups V4
and V5, verification documents must be received by the institution no
later than 120 days after the student's last date of enrollment for the
2025-2026 award year or September 19, 2026, whichever is earlier. For
students selected for Verification Tracking Groups V4 and V5,
institutions must submit identity verification results no later than 60
days following the institution's first request to the student to submit
the documentation or October 28, 2025 (60 days after the release of the
Verification of Identity functionality in the FAFSA Partner Portal) for
the 2025-2026 Award Year, whichever is later.
For all title IV, HEA programs except for (1) Direct PLUS Loans
that will be made to parent borrowers, and (2) Direct Unsubsidized
Loans that will be made to dependent students who have been determined
by the institution, pursuant to section 479A(a) of the HEA, to be
eligible for such a loan without providing parental information on the
FAFSA, the ISIR or FAFSA Submission Summary must have an official
Student Aid Index (SAI) and the ISIR or FAFSA Submission Summary must
be received by the institution no later than the earlier of the
student's last date of enrollment for the 2025-2026 award year or
September 19, 2026. For the two exceptions mentioned above, the ISIR or
FAFSA Submission Summary must be received by the institution by the
same dates noted in this paragraph, but the ISIR or FAFSA Submission
Summary is not required to have an official SAI.
For a student who is requesting aid through the Pell Grant, FSEOG,
or FWS programs or for a student requesting Direct Subsidized Loans,
who does not meet the conditions for a late disbursement under 34 CFR
668.164(j), a valid ISIR or valid FAFSA Submission Summary must be
received by the institution by the student's last date of enrollment
for the 2025-2026 award year or September 19, 2026, whichever is
earlier.
In accordance with 34 CFR 668.164(j)(4)(i), an institution may not
make a late disbursement of title IV, HEA program funds later than 180
days after the date of the institution's determination that the student
was no longer enrolled. Table A provides that, to make a late
disbursement of title IV, HEA program funds, an institution must
receive a valid ISIR or valid FAFSA Submission Summary no later than
180 days after its determination that the student was no longer
enrolled, but not later than September 19, 2026.
Table B--2025-2026 Award Year Deadline Dates by Which an
Institution Must Submit Disbursement Information for the Pell Grant,
Direct Loan, and TEACH Grant Programs.
For the Pell Grant, Direct Loan, and TEACH Grant programs, Table B
provides the earliest disbursement date, the earliest dates for
institutions to submit disbursement records to the Department's Common
Origination and Disbursement (COD) System, and deadline dates by which
institutions must submit disbursement and origination records.
For the 2025-2026 Award Year, an institution must submit Pell
Grant, Direct Loan, and TEACH Grant disbursement records to COD, no
later than November 30, 2026 or 15 days after making the disbursement
or becoming aware of the need to adjust a previously reported
disbursement, whichever is later. In accordance with 34 CFR 668.164(a),
title IV, HEA program funds are disbursed on the date that the
institution: (a) credits those funds to a student's account in the
institution's general ledger or any subledger of the general ledger; or
(b) pays those funds to a student directly. Title IV, HEA program funds
are disbursed even if an institution uses its own funds in advance of
receiving program funds from the Department.
An institution's failure to submit disbursement records within the
required timeframe may result in the Department rejecting all or part
of the reported disbursement. Such failure may also result in an audit
or program review finding or the initiation of an adverse action, such
as a fine or other penalty for such failure, in accordance with subpart
G of the General Provisions regulations in 34 CFR part 668.
Deadline Dates for Enrollment Reporting by Institutions.
In accordance with 34 CFR 674.19(f), 682.610(c), 685.309(b), and
690.83(b)(2), upon receipt of an enrollment report from the Secretary,
institutions must update all information included in the report and
return the report to the Secretary in a manner and format prescribed by
the Secretary and within the timeframe prescribed by the Secretary.
Consistent with the National Student Loan Data System (NSLDS)
Enrollment Reporting Guide, the Secretary has determined that
institutions must report at least every two months. Institutions may
find the NSLDS Enrollment Reporting Guide in the ``Knowledge Center''
via Federal Student Aid's (FSA) Partner Connect website at: https://fsapartners.ed.gov/knowledge-center.

\1\ The deadline for electronic transactions is 11:59 p.m. (Central Time) on the deadline date. Transmissions
must be completed and accepted before 12:00 midnight to meet the deadline. If transmissions are started before
12:00 midnight but are not completed until after 12:00 midnight, those transmissions do not meet the deadline.
In addition, any transmission submitted on or just prior to the deadline date that is rejected may not be
reprocessed because the deadline will have passed by the time the user gets the information notifying them of
the rejection.
\2\ The date the ISIR/FAFSA Submission Summary transaction was processed by FPS is considered to be the date the
institution received the ISIR or FAFSA Submission Summary regardless of whether the institution has downloaded
the ISIR from its Student Aid Internet Gateway (SAIG) mailbox or when the student submits the FAFSA Submission
Summary to the institution.
\3\ Although the Secretary has set this deadline date for the submission of verification documents, if
corrections are required, deadline dates for submission of paper or electronic corrections and, for Pell Grant
applicants and applicants selected for verification, deadline dates for the submission of a valid FAFSA
Submission Summary or valid ISIR to the institution must still be met. An institution may establish an earlier
deadline for the submission of verification documents for purposes of the Campus-Based programs and the Direct
Loan Program, but it cannot be later than this deadline date.
\4\ Note that changes to previously submitted identity verification results must be updated within 30 days of
the institution becoming aware that a change has occurred.

\1\ A COD Processing Year is a period of time in which institutions are permitted to submit Direct Loan records
to the COD System that are related to a given award year. For a Direct Loan, the period of time includes loans
that have a loan period covering any day in the 2025-2026 award year.
\2\ Transmissions must be completed and accepted before the designated processing time on the deadline
submission date. The designated processing time is published annually via an electronic announcement posted to
the Knowledge Center via FSA's Partner Connect website at: https://fsapartners.ed.gov/knowledge-center. If
transmissions are started at the designated time, but are not completed until after the designated time, those
transmissions will not meet the deadline. In addition, any transmission submitted on or just prior to the
deadline date that is rejected may not be reprocessed because the deadline will have passed by the time the
user gets the information notifying him or her of the rejection.
\3\ Applies only to students enrolled in clock-hour and nonterm credit-hour educational programs.
Note: The COD System must accept origination data for a student from an institution before it accepts
disbursement information from the institution for that student. Institutions may submit origination and
disbursement data for a student in the same transmission. However, if the origination data is rejected, the
disbursement data is rejected.
